The excerpt from the Declaration of Independence that best demonstrates its connection to the Enlightenment idea of natural rights is:
- OD. We hold these truths to be self-evident, that all men are created equal
This excerpt reflects the Enlightenment concept of natural rights by stating that all individuals are inherently equal and possess unalienable rights, such as life, liberty, and the pursuit of happiness.
